What is Hypercast?

hypercast is a tool that enables broadcasting of live peer-to-peer video streams to dat:// enabled web browsers such as Beaker Browser. When users connect to the broadcast, they begin redistributing the broadcast data amongst themselves, bypassing the need for a central broadcasting server and the significant bandwidth required to stream the same data to every user. hypercast is a fork of the hypervision app, leveraging modules from the dat:// ecosystem like hyperdrive and hyperdiscovery
